Output ec127c57e523e6235f1cc6ba379205798e25d3a21a2f0ec75c38b2d59fce3fe9:5

value
22894
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a01341bf2c7d95446d4b1084ddbd81ff173e059158ec9d80e61a3978bffba54d
address
bc1p5qf5r0ev0k25gm2tzzzdm0vplutnupv3trkfmq8xrguh30lm54xsd5g65a
transaction
ec127c57e523e6235f1cc6ba379205798e25d3a21a2f0ec75c38b2d59fce3fe9
spent
true